Cost of Living in Rushford, NY: What You Need to Know

With a cost of living index of 81, Rushford, NY is a very affordable place to live. Living here is 19% cheaper than the national average and 30% below the New York state average of 111. Rushford is a small community of 396 residents.

The median household income in Rushford is $52,188, which is 31% lower than the national median of $75,149. Lower incomes here are balanced by the significantly lower cost of living, stretching each dollar further.

Climate is another factor for anyone considering a move to Rushford. The area sees an average annual temperature of 46.4°F, with summers averaging 66°F and winters around 26°F. Annual rainfall totals 37.2 inches spread over roughly 172 days. Cold winters mean higher heating bills, an important cost-of-living consideration.
